I have never cared much for sticking with the rules of the game, or rules as written (RAW).

After all, what are the RAW?

When the Quickstart came out, the RAW were the Quickstart rules.

Then, RAW were the RuneQuest Glorantha rules.

After that, the RAW were the RuneQuest Glorantha rules plus pages of errata and clarifications.

Then the RAW included RuneQuest Glorantha plus errata/clarifications, plus Glorantha Bestiary.

Then RAW included RuneQuest Glorantha plus errata/clarifications, plus Glorantha Bestiary, plus Weapons & Equipment.

Soon RAW will include RuneQuest Glorantha plus errata/clarifications, Glorantha Bestiary, Weapons & Equipment, Gods and Goddesses of Glorantha and HeroQuesting rules.

So, what is RAW?

To me, it is a pretty meaningless concept.

We have always used houserules in all of our campaigns and I will probably continue to do so. This means that all my supplements don't use RAW but use extensions of RuneQuest.
